The iPSLE is intended for pupils in overseas schools that adopt a curriculum similar to the Singapore school curriculum. It is the international version of the Primary School Leaving Examination (PSLE) taken by pupils in Singapore at the end of 6 years of education in a primary school.
It was introduced with the aim of providing benchmarking for overseas schools which are interested to benchmark against Singapore's standard. The
iPSLE will be conducted in June/July each year and the results will be released in November of the same year.
